SAKHIR, Bahrain (AP) — Ferrari’s Carlos Sainz set the fastest time during preseason testing on Friday, while Kevin Magnussen was back for Haas in the place of fired Russian driver Nikita Mazepin.
Carlos Sainz concluded another strong day of testing for Ferrari, though Max Verstappen and Lewis Hamilton were much stronger than on Day 1. Pierre Gasly was the fastest on Thursday for Red Bull’s sister team, AlphaTauri, though Yuki Tsunoda’s performance for the team on Friday left him in 10th place.
Neither Hamilton nor team-mate George Russell have appeared completely comfortable with their car during this week’s Bahrain test, with the Mercedes not looking at ease in the rapidly changing conditions at Sakhir.

MANAMA : Red Bull team boss Christian Horner on Friday made clear that he had no concerns over the legality of rival team Mercedes' new car after having reportedly suggested on Thursday that it contravened the spirit of the rules.
